Easy Funds Management Tips for a Safe Lifetime
Building a solid financial well-being doesn't demand complicated schemes . Start with straightforward budget management . Here's a few useful guidelines to get you going :
- Track your spending . Use a financial program or a notebook.
- Develop a spending outline. Set aside money for essential bills and financial goals.
- Settle your bills promptly to escape penalties .
- Build an unexpected fund . Aim for six months' worth of living outlays.
- Lower liabilities . Target on high-interest balances initially .
By implementing these straightforward finance handling practices , you can lay the groundwork for a brighter financial outlook.
Investing for Beginners: Common Mistakes to Avoid
Embarking beginning on an portfolio journey can feel overwhelming , and many inexperienced investors stumble into some frequent blunders. One significant mistake is failing from do sufficient research; simply acquiring stocks due to a friend advised them is rarely a path for success. Additionally , chasing “hot” opportunities without understanding the fundamental business is get more info another typical trap. Ignoring diversification is also vital ; putting all your eggs in one stock leaves you susceptible to substantial declines. Finally, letting emotions drive your decisions – selling in a panic or buying excitedly – can severely erode your returns . Avoid these problems and you’ll be far on your way to building a rewarding investment plan .
- Conduct thorough research before any investment.
- Avoid chasing fleeting trends.
- Always diversify your portfolio.
- Manage your emotions and avoid impulsive decisions.
